Subject: On-call handover — GraphLattice

Hi Priya,

Handing over GraphLattice, our dependency graph visualizer. The renderer occasionally stalls on graphs above 12k nodes; I've mitigated with the layout cache flag, but the root cause is still open. Watch the nightly ingest job — it failed twice this week and needs a manual retry. Full notes are in the runbook. For escalations, reach the core maintainer here.

escalation mailbox, bafog-fafog: ulador@paliqlabs.internal

## Authentication

The Wrenfold profile store is sharded by user ID modulo 64, and plugin requests are routed automatically — you never address a shard directly. What you do need is a valid plugin credential, passed in the request header on every call. Credentials are scoped per plugin and grant read access to profile fields declared in your manifest; writes require a separate elevation request. Unauthenticated calls return 403 regardless of shard. For local development against the sandbox cluster, authenticate with the key below.

service key, fawip-bajef: kto11_Qt5wZK9vdNC

## Onboarding — Markdown Pipeline (Inkmere)

Inkmere docs render through a three-stage pipeline: parse, sanitize, emit. Releases rebuild all templates; never hot-patch emitted HTML. Broken renders usually mean a sanitizer rule change — check the rules diff first. The render cluster only accepts builds from the release channel, and every build artifact must be signed before upload. Sign artifacts with the deploy key below.

release key, hafop-tajef: bky13_s2vaFVNJTHfBL